A very fine 19th Century polished brass curb fender in the manner of Adams, fully restored and of exceptional quality. The rolled top is raised over a panelled frieze of bowfront form decorated throughout with beautiful arrangements of Neoclassical motifs comprising of garlands of bellhusks, ribbon bows, cabochons and elegant beaded motif detail, supported on moulded platform base.
